Output 2ec7bce98ba8c4d1c6828af08e618df5d91570b02d42bcaf4f5f1e90ee665e55:26

value
142358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a3fbec97af82300fb8eb2e32457b9e05de9fd75 OP_EQUAL
address
39vD6uZAxyChPVCdRDJA7DQ3zG1B9pcmxM
transaction
2ec7bce98ba8c4d1c6828af08e618df5d91570b02d42bcaf4f5f1e90ee665e55
spent
true